Track Crew News - August 2010

Rain seems to be the flavor of the month so even we have the odd bit of mud about. Tracks are quieter just the old (and young) harder core riders around

We are busy working on the Rotary Ride cleaning up after the logging and improving some of the bad maintenance spots.
The overall plan is to keep improving the Rotary Ride the best we can easing out the hills and improving the route back to Taupo.

When we can get some funding we want to do a major realignment at the Huka Falls end which will take the bikes off the walking track plus fix the shitty hill on the Eastern Bypass. We expect a lot more people to be doing the Aratiatia track down to the new bridge once the bypass opens.

Funding Approved for the Lake Track

BikeTaupo Media Release

KawaKawa bay Lookout

The Ministry of Tourism advised today that Government funding will be made available to Bike Taupo to construct the Lake Track Cycle Trail on the western shore of Lake Taupo.
The track as proposed is one of the National Cycleways Projects and will be approximately 100 kilometres in length.


The first part of this track, approximately 35 kilometres, has already been constructed by Bike Taupo and includes the popular W2K Track.
The funding now made available by the Government is to construct the remaining 65 kilometres of the track through to the Waihaha Road bridge on State Highway 32.
